Oddsmakers view Ohio State as No. 2 CFP threat

The Ohio State Buckeyes climbed to No. 3 in the Associated Press Top 25 poll following their season-opening rout of Nebraska, and they’re considered the second betting favorite for the national title by several sportsbooks.

While Alabama (+275) has the second shortest national title odds at DraftKings behind Clemson (+120), Ohio State has surpassed the Crimson Tide at several other sportsbooks.

FanDuel was offering Clemson at +175 on Monday, followed by Ohio State (+200) and Alabama (+400). The next closest team was Georgia at +1600.

BetMGM also listed Clemson (+130) as the clear current favorite, with Ohio State and Alabama each at +350. Meanwhile, William Hill had moved Ohio State (+275) ahead of Alabama (+300) with Clemson the +160 favorite.

Clemson quarterback Trevor Lawrence remains the overwhelming favorite to win the Heisman Trophy.

Lawrence was being offered at -100 by FanDuel and -167 by DraftKings.

FanDuel listed Ohio State quarterback Justin Fields at +250, followed by Alabama quarterback Mac Jones at +500, with no other player being offered at less than +3000.

Jones (+250) is second to Lawrence at DraftKings, with Fields third at +400 and the next closest player being Florida Gators quarterback Kyle Trask at +1600.
